Output 7640739cfdf520d72b53a2f93d6bfbcca031882310ce584124e050bdaeb2c40a:1

value
1891389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ff0ca3f9317afc5742935ae52be2e99cbf684cc6 OP_EQUAL
address
3QwbNjqKDtkrTwbvH8Mj25P4aDk4k1h3ps
transaction
7640739cfdf520d72b53a2f93d6bfbcca031882310ce584124e050bdaeb2c40a
spent
true